Synopsis: Spare is a forsaken pup who knows far too much to be allowed to leave. She's been drafting an elaborate "escape" plan that avoids raising any unwanted alarms, but this plan gets thwarted once she meets her fated mate in the most bizarre circumstances!

Spare has always lived in the shadow of her sister Lily, until Duncan enters her life, claiming they are destined to be soulmates. Despite her inner desires for Duncan, Spare is determined to prioritize her studies and maintain her independence after graduation. However, as their connection deepens, Spare faces a heart-wrenching choice between following her own path or surrendering to the intertwined fate that binds her to Duncan.
